Back in July 2013, the Woodhorn Charitable Trust were recipients of funding from the Happy Museum for their project, “Stand Up for Woodhorn: Making a Case for Comedy in Museums.” For more information on their project see HERE.

 

In order to chart the progress of their project, the Woodhorn have created a great new blog, introducing the lead comedian in residence, Seymour Mace, and documenting events such as a “Meet the Comedian” afternoon at the Northumberland History Fair. To learn more, see the blog HERE.
